Cecil Hurt, of The Tuscaloosa News, joined Host of "Southern Fried Sports" Travis Reier Tuesday morning to talk quarterbacks after the Manning Passing Academy, provide an update on Kira Lewis Jr., and flashed back to the 1980 football season.

"Mississippi State either did or did not fumble late in the game," Hurt Reminisced the 6-3 loss to Mississippi State, which ended the Crimson Tide's 28 game win streak. "There are a lot of Alabama Fans that swear that State fumbled it in the end zone and Alabama recovered it. I think some of those fans are just in denial that Alabama could lose those games."

"I will say is it was a last minute decision," Hurt told Travis about Tagovailoa missing the Manning Passing Academy. "The Mannings were expecting him to be there, so they made that decision the day-of or a day before. Everything I've heard is that it's fine, just that he has some tightness."
